(Reuters) - Democratic President-elect Joe Biden has begun nominating the members of his Cabinet and White House, working to fulfill his promise to build an administration that reflects the nation's diversity.
Biden will name former Obama administration official Jeff Zients to be his White House coronavirus coordinator and former Surgeon General Vivek Murthy to return to his previous role, Politico reported. He already has named leading members of his foreign policy and economic teams.
Here are some recent important picks and top contenders for prominent positions, according to Reuters reporting:
Coronavirus Coordinator: Jeff Zients
Zients, an economic adviser touted for his managerial skills, was tapped to save the bungled launch of the Affordable Care Act's website for former President Barack Obama.
Under Biden, he will oversee an unprecedented operation to distribute hundreds of millions of doses of a new vaccine, coordinating efforts across multiple federal agencies.
Surgeon General: Vivek Murthy
A physician and former surgeon general, Murthy gained prominence in recent months as co-chairman of Biden's advisory board dealing with the coronavirus pandemic, which the president-elect has pledged to make his top priority.
Treasury Secretary: Janet Yellen
The former Federal Reserve chair deepened the central bank's focus on workers and inequality and has remained active in policy debates at the Brookings Institution think tank since Republican President Donald Trump replaced her as head of the central bank in 2018.
